American Zoo Association

The American Zoo & Aquarium Association (AZA) is a professional organization that sets standards for the ethical care and management of animals in zoos and aquariums across North America. It promotes conservation, education, and research initiatives to protect wildlife and their habitats. AZA accreditation signifies that a facility meets rigorous standards for animal care, safety, and conservation efforts. The organization also facilitates collaboration among institutions to improve animal welfare and support global conservation projects, helping ensure that zoos and aquariums contribute meaningfully to preserving biodiversity.
